Track Your Professional Growth and Achievements

As professionals, it's essential to not only focus on our daily tasks but also on our long-term growth and accomplishments. Tracking your professional journey can help you stay motivated, identify areas for improvement, and showcase your achievements to potential employers or clients. Here are some tips on how to track your professional growth and achievements effectively:

Set Clear Goals

Start by setting clear and achievable goals for your professional development. Whether it's gaining a new skill, completing a project, or reaching a career milestone, having specific goals will give you direction and purpose.

Keep a Journal

Maintaining a journal or digital log of your daily accomplishments, challenges, and learnings can help you track your progress over time. Reflect on what you have achieved and areas where you can improve.

Seek Feedback

Feedback from mentors, colleagues, or supervisors can provide valuable insights into your performance and areas for growth. Be open to constructive criticism and use it to enhance your skills.

Update Your Resume and Portfolio

Regularly update your resume and portfolio with your latest achievements, projects, and skills. This will not only help you track your progress but also showcase your abilities to potential employers or clients.

Join Professional Networks

Networking with other professionals in your industry can help you stay updated on industry trends, gain new perspectives, and create opportunities for growth and collaboration.

Celebrate Milestones

Don't forget to celebrate your achievements and milestones along the way. Recognizing your accomplishments, no matter how small, can boost your confidence and motivation.

Invest in Continuous Learning

Professional growth is a lifelong journey. Invest in continuous learning through courses, workshops, conferences, or certifications to stay relevant and enhance your skills.

Track Your Progress

Use tools like spreadsheets, goal-tracking apps, or project management software to monitor your progress towards your professional goals. Regularly review your performance and make adjustments as needed.

Stay Positive and Persistent

Remember that professional growth takes time and effort. Stay positive, stay persistent, and keep pushing yourself to reach new heights in your career.
